期刊文献+

矢量观测确定卫星姿态的预测粒子滤波算法 被引量:3

Particle Filtering Fusing Predictive Filter for Attitude Determination from Vector Observations
在线阅读 下载PDF
导出
摘要 在矢量观测的基础上,针对单独的星敏感器定姿,提出了一种将粒子滤波(PF)和预测滤波相结合的姿态确定算法,通过设计粒子初始化,结合重要性采样、重采样和规则化等手段,成功地将姿态四元数作为状态粒子进行更新和传递,避免了状态方程的线性化和协方差矩阵的计算;利用预测滤波算法估计模型误差和姿态角速度,在保证滤波精度的同时,有效降低了粒子滤波器的维数。实验在某对地观测通用小卫星平台上进行,选取卫星自由飞行状态和飞轮控制对地稳定模式,分别对滤波器进行了仿真,实验结果验证了该算法对本质非线性、非高斯的卫星姿态估计问题具有快速的收敛性能和良好的稳定精度。该方法还为粒子滤波器的设计和无角速度敏感器测量的飞行器姿态确定提供了借鉴。 A particle filter fusing predictive filter based on vector observations is presented for satellite attitude determination using solely star sensor without gyro.By designing proper particles initialization,using sequential important sampling,resampling and regularization,the attitude quaternion can be directly updated and transferred as states,thus avoiding linearization of system state equations and covariance matrix calculation.By using predictive filter to estimate model error and attitude angular rate,the particles dimensions are reduced effectively without loss of estimation accuracy.A simulation study in a satellite platform of a lab,including earth-pointing mode and free flying mode,is used to verify the fast convergence rate and the steady accuracy of the algorithm,and results demonstrate that the algorithm is robust in nonlinear and non-Gaussian scenarios.The new method supplies experiences to particle filter design and other kinds of attitude determination without angular rate sensors as well.
出处 《宇航学报》 EI CAS CSCD 北大核心 2011年第5期1077-1085,共9页 Journal of Astronautics
基金 国家自然科学基金(40374054) 科技部863计划(2008AA12A216)
关键词 姿态估计 星敏感器 粒子滤波 预测滤波 矢量观测 Attitude estimation Star sensor Particle filter Predictive filter Vector observation
  • 相关文献

参考文献14

  • 1Shuster M D, Oh S D. Three-axis attitude determination from vector observations[ J]. Journal of Guidance and Control, 1981, 4(1): 70 -77.
  • 2Gai E, Daly K, Harrison J, et al. Star-sensor- based satellite attitude/attitude rate estimator [ J ]. Journal of Guidance, Control, and Dynamics, 1995, 8(5): 560-565.
  • 3Psiaki M L, Martel F, Pal P K. Three-axis attitude determination via Kalman filtering of magnetometer data [ J ]. Journal of Guid- ance, Control, and Dynamics, 1990, 13(3) : 506 -514.
  • 4Challa M, Natanson G, Wheeler C. Simultaneous determination of spacecraft attitude and rates using only a magnetometer [ C ]. AIAA/AAS Astrodynamics Specialist Conference, AIAA, San Diego, CA, 1996:544-553.
  • 5Lu P. Nonlinear predictive controllers for continuous systems [J]. Journal of Guidance, Control, and Dynamics, 1994, 17 (3) : 553 -560.
  • 6Mook D J, Junkins J L. Minimum model error estimation for poorly modeled dynamic systems[ J]. Journal of Guidance, Con- trol, and Dynamics, 1988, 3(4) : 367 -375.
  • 7Crassidis J L, Markley F L. Predictive fihering for attitude esti- mation without rate sensors [ J ]. Journal of Guidance, Control, and Dynamics, 1997, 20(3): 522-527.
  • 8Cheng Y, Crassidis .l L. Particle fihering for sequential space- craft attitude estimation[ C ]. AIAA Guidance, Navigation, and Control Conference and Exhibit, Providence, RI, USA, 2004:1 -18.
  • 9姜雪原,马广富,胡庆雷.基于粒子滤波和UKF联合滤波的卫星姿态估计[J].哈尔滨工业大学学报,2007,39(3):337-341. 被引量:10
  • 10Oshman Y, Carmi A. Attitude estimation from vector observations using a genetic algorithm - embedded quaternion particle filter [J]. Journal of Guidance, Control, and Dynamics, 2006, 29 (4) : 879 -891.

二级参考文献15

  • 1LEFFERTS E J,MARKLEY F L,SHUSTER M D.Kalman filtering for spacecraft attitude estimation[J].Journal of Guidance,1982,5(5):417 -429.
  • 2SHUSTER M D.Kalman filtering of spacecraft attitude and the QUEST model[J].Journal of the Astronautical Sciences,1990,38(3):377-393.
  • 3PSIAKI M L,MARTEL F,PAL P K.Three-axis attitude determination via kalman filtering of magnetometer data[J].Journal of Guidance,1990,13(3):506 -514.
  • 4VATHSAL S.Spacecraft attitude determination using a second-order nonlinear filter[J].Journal of Guidance,Control,and Dynamics,1987,10(6):559-566.
  • 5KASDIN N J.Recursive satellite attitude estimation with the two-step optimal estimator[C]//AIAA Guidance,Navigation,and Control Conference and Exhibit,Monterey,California:AIAA,2002:2002-4462.
  • 6CHIANG Y T,WANG L S,CHANG F R,et al.Constrainedfiltering method for attitude determination using GPS and gyro[J].IEE Proc.Radar Sonar Navigation,2002,149(5):258 -264.
  • 7JULIER S J,UHLMANN J K,DURRANT-WHYTE H F.A new approach for the nonlinear transformation of means and covariances in filters and estimators[J].IEEE Transactions on Automatic Control,2000,45(3):477-482.
  • 8HAYKIN S.Kalman Filtering and Neural Network[M].New York:John Wiley Publishing,2001.
  • 9GORDON N J,SALMOND D J,SMITH A F M.Novel approach to nonlinear/non-gaussian bayesian state estimation[J].IEE Proceedings -F,1993,140(2):107 -113.
  • 10ARULAMPLAM M S,MASKELL S,GORDON N,et al.A tutorial on particle filters for online nonlinear/nongaussian bayesian tracking[J].IEEE Transactions on Signal Processing,2002,50(2):174-185.

共引文献9

同被引文献38

  • 1段方,刘建业,李丹.微小卫星太阳敏感器/磁强计实时标定算法研究[J].航空学报,2007,28(1):173-176. 被引量:6
  • 2Stoll E,Letschnik J,Walter U. On-orbit servicing[J].IEEE Robotics and Automation Magazine,2009,(04):29-33.
  • 3McLoughlin T H,Campbell M. Distributed estimate fusion filter for large spacecraft formations[R].Honolulu,HI,United States:American Institute of Aeronautics and Astronautics Inc,2008.
  • 4Murrell J W. Precision attitude determination for multimission spacecraft[A].Palo,CA,United States,1978.
  • 5Andrews S F,Bilanow S. Recent flight results of the TRMM Kalman filter[A].Monterey,CA,United states,2002.
  • 6Abdelrahman M,Park S Y. Sigma-point kalman filtering for spacecraft attitude and rate estimation using magnetometer measurements[J].IEEE Transactions on Aerospace and Electronic Systems,2011,(02):1401-1415.
  • 7Lefferts E J,Markley F L,Shuster M D. Kalman filtering for spacecraft attitude estimation[J].Journal of Guidance,Control & Dynamics,1982,(05):417-429.
  • 8Crassidis J L,Markley F L. Unscented filtering for spacecraft attitude estimation[J].Journal of Guidance,Control & Dynamics,2003,(04):536-542.
  • 9Carmi A,Oshman Y. Fast particle filtering for attitude and angular-rate estimation from vector observations[J].Journal of Guidance,Control & Dynamics,2009,(01):70-78.
  • 10Arasaratnam I,Haykin S. Cubature Kalman filters[J].IEEE Transactions on Automatic Control,2009,(06):1254-1269.

引证文献3

二级引证文献31

相关作者

内容加载中请稍等...

相关机构

内容加载中请稍等...

相关主题

内容加载中请稍等...

浏览历史

内容加载中请稍等...
;
使用帮助 返回顶部